
Project Name: Media Sharing Community Platform
Launch Date: 2020
Website: sb19.com
Role: Owner & Developer (Web Manager, SEO Specialist, Platform Architect & Designer)
The Media Sharing Community Platform is a dynamic, interactive website designed to foster a vibrant online community where users can share videos, photos, and text posts. It integrates gamification elements such as points, badges, and a leaderboard to recognize top contributors and encourage ongoing engagement. The platform connects users through creative and shareable content while cultivating a sense of friendly competition and community spirit.
Project Brief
This platform was conceived as a community-driven media sharing hub to give users a space to showcase their creativity and interact meaningfully with others. Designed to enhance user retention and engagement, it combines content sharing with gamification. The goal was to build an intuitive, fast, and scalable platform tailored specifically for a growing online community while maintaining robust performance and SEO best practices.
Features and Functionality
- Media Upload & Sharing: Users can upload and share videos, photos, and text posts seamlessly.
- User Points & Badges: Members earn points for uploading content, engaging with others, and achieving milestones.
- Leaderboard: A live leaderboard highlights top users, motivating members to increase activity and climb the ranks.
- Responsive Design: Ensures excellent user experience across desktops, tablets, and mobile devices.
- SEO-Friendly Structure: Optimized pages and URLs for maximum visibility on search engines.
- Interactive Profiles: Users can personalize profiles, view achievements, and track their rankings.
- File Management System: Handles media files efficiently with organized storage and backups.
Design & Development
Built from Scratch: Fully developed using a customized PHP platform, with attention to scalability, performance, and extensibility.
Technology Stack:
- Custom PHP Platform – Tailored development for unique functionality and flexibility.
- MySQL – Robust database to store user data, media, points, and rankings.
- cPanel (Webhost) – Simplified hosting management and site operations.
- HTML, CSS & Bootstrap – Responsive and visually appealing front-end design.
- API Integrations – For social sharing, analytics, and additional features.
- File Management System – To securely store and serve media files efficiently.
- SEO Implementation – Technical SEO practices to drive organic traffic and improve discoverability.
Impact & Success
- Increased User Engagement: Gamification and leaderboards keep users returning and participating actively.
- Creative Community: Encourages diverse content creation and sharing among members.
- Stronger Digital Presence: Improved SEO visibility and consistent growth in organic traffic.
- High Retention Rate: Interactive elements and recognition programs foster loyalty among members.
Future Enhancements
- Mobile App Development: Extend the experience with dedicated iOS and Android apps.
- Advanced Analytics: Provide users with insights into their content performance and engagement.
- Expanded Social Integrations: Enable seamless sharing across more social networks.
- Content Moderation Tools: Introduce AI-assisted moderation to maintain a positive community environment.
Conclusion
The Media Sharing Community Platform exemplifies how thoughtful design and development can create an engaging and thriving online community. By blending content sharing, gamification, and responsive design, it successfully fosters interaction and creativity. With planned enhancements and ongoing improvements, the platform continues to evolve as a cornerstone for community engagement and user-generated content.